How much does an Independent Field Inspector make?
As of Aug 9, 2026, the average annual pay for an Independent Field Inspector in the United States is $52,383 a year.
Just in case you need a simple salary calculator, that works out to be approximately $25.18 an hour. This is the equivalent of $1,007/week or $4,365/month.
While ZipRecruiter is seeing annual salaries as high as $93,500 and as low as $11,000, the majority of Independent Field Inspector salaries currently range between $40,000 (25th percentile) to $60,000 (75th percentile) with top earners (90th percentile) making $77,000 annually across the United States. The average pay range for an Independent Field Inspector varies greatly (by as much as 20000), which suggests there may be many opportunities for advancement and increased pay based on skill level, location and years of experience.
An Independent Field Inspector in your area makes on average $50,597 per year, or $1,786 (3.410%) less than the national average annual salary of $52,383. Ohio ranks number 38 out of 50 states nationwide for Independent Field Inspector salaries.
